appropriate |
right for the purpose; proper. |
commission |
the act of performing or carrying out (something); the act of committing. |
convey |
to carry from one place or person to another. |
delete |
to remove from a written work. |
diary |
a daily record of a person's experiences and thoughts. |
effect |
something produced by a cause. |
establish |
to successfully start or make something that did not exist before. |
gravity |
the force by which all objects in the universe are attracted to each other. |
meddle |
to take part in matters that concern someone else, without being asked; interfere. |
membership |
the state of belonging to a particular group or organization. |
mob |
a large crowd of angry or excited people. |
profession |
a job or type of work that needs special training or study. |
slimy |
made of or like a slippery liquid. |
soot |
a fine, black powder made during burning. Soot collects in chimneys or is carried into the air in smoke. |
witness |
a person who sees or hears something that happened. |
